MySQL停止运行指南
mysql如何停止运行

首页 2025-07-30 10:36:13



MySQL如何停止运行:一份详尽的指南 在数据库管理的日常工作中,MySQL的启动与停止是基本操作之一

    虽然启动MySQL服务是大多数用户经常执行的任务,但知道如何正确、安全地停止MySQL服务同样重要

    本文将深入探讨MySQL停止运行的几种方法,并分析每种方法的适用场景,旨在帮助数据库管理员和开发者更加从容地管理MySQL服务

     一、为何需要停止MySQL 在探讨如何停止MySQL之前,我们首先需要理解为何需要停止服务

    停止MySQL服务可能出于多种原因,包括但不限于: 1.系统维护:进行操作系统升级、硬件维护或更换时,需要确保数据安全,停止MySQL服务可以防止数据在维护过程中受损

     2.软件更新:MySQL自身或相关软件的更新可能要求服务停止,以确保更新过程的顺利进行

     3.资源释放:在服务器资源紧张的情况下,暂时停止非关键服务可以释放内存、CPU等资源,以供其他重要任务使用

     4.故障排除:当MySQL出现性能问题或错误时,停止并重启服务有时可以解决问题

     二、停止MySQL的方法 停止MySQL服务的方法因操作系统和MySQL安装方式的不同而有所差异

    以下是一些常见的方法: 1. 使用服务管理工具 在Windows系统中,可以通过“服务”管理工具来停止MySQL服务

    打开“运行”对话框,输入`services.msc`,找到MySQL服务(可能显示为“MySQL”或“MySQL Server”等),右键选择“停止”即可

     在Linux系统中,可以使用`systemctl`命令来管理服务

    例如,要停止名为`mysqld`的MySQL服务,可以执行以下命令: bash sudo systemctl stop mysqld 2. 使用MySQL自带的工具 MySQL提供了多种自带的工具和命令来管理服务的运行状态

    例如,`mysqladmin`是一个常用的命令行工具,可以用来停止MySQL服务器

    使用以下命令可以安全地关闭服务器: bash mysqladmin -u root -p shutdown 执行此命令后,系统会提示输入root用户的密码

    输入正确的密码后,MySQL服务器将开始关闭进程

     3. 使用SQL命令 在某些情况下,你也可以通过连接到MySQL服务器并执行SQL命令来停止服务

    登录到MySQL后,执行以下命令: sql SHUTDOWN; 这条命令会告诉MySQL服务器开始关闭过程

    请注意,执行此命令需要具有足够的权限

     三、停止MySQL的注意事项 在停止MySQL服务之前,有几个重要的注意事项需要牢记: 1.备份数据:在进行任何可能影响数据完整性的操作之前,始终确保已经备份了重要数据

    虽然正常停止MySQL服务通常不会导致数据丢失,但预防措施总是明智的

     2.检查活动连接:在停止服务之前,最好检查当前活动的数据库连接

    如果有重要的查询或事务正在执行,最好等待它们完成或手动处理它们,以避免数据不一致

     3.通知相关团队:如果MySQL服务是多个团队或应用程序共享的,那么在停止服务之前通知相关利益相关者是很重要的

    这可以确保他们知道即将发生的维护窗口,并据此安排自己的工作

     4.记录操作:记录你执行的所有步骤和命令

    这不仅有助于跟踪问题,还可以在出现问题时提供有价值的故障排除信息

     四、结论 停止MySQL服务是一项需要谨慎处理的任务

    通过了解不同的停止方法以及执行这些操作时的最佳实践,数据库管理员和开发者可以更加自信地管理他们的MySQL环境

    无论是进行例行维护、软件更新还是故障排除,正确地停止MySQL服务都是确保数据安全和系统稳定性的关键步骤

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道